Amazon.com

Lakeside's concept-album ploys often went not much further than their album covers, which depicted them in various movie-inspired guises. On the sleeve of <I>Untouchables</I>, they're Chicago-style gangsters, and they actually spin two or three tunes that tie in to the idea: "Raid" the dance floor, they order, but keep your "Alibi" straight and remember that you're "Untouchable." Fewer ballads and a couple of more dance tracks would more satisfyingly unbalance the album, but this 1982 disc nonetheless brings a thoroughly innocent, entertaining era back to life in your speakers. <I>--Rickey Wright</I>

4 out of 5 stars Turn the music up!.......2000-09-20

I felt that this was one of Lakeside's final great albums. My favorite was the funky "Turn The Music Up". For a group that did not use horns in their music, I still felt that this was lakeside at their late peak. No, it does not sport their greatest hits, this was a strong and entertaining album.
